Transaction edf8316797bdfc7cc6293a7503fa4a09082fda8775b4f3b740ce253fb3b695c6
1 Input
1 Output
-
edf8316797bdfc7cc6293a7503fa4a09082fda8775b4f3b740ce253fb3b695c6:0
- value
- 99823486
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1faeccc093d8e0cb0080644ef9879fe3493fee04 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13tXMFYNqfo1qbhzza5H8McdMUwtQyTcuf